Understanding the Basics of Property and Casualty Insurance

Property and Casualty (P&C) insurance is a broad category of insurance policies designed to protect individuals and businesses from financial losses. It encompasses two primary areas: property insurance, which covers damage to physical assets like homes, businesses, and vehicles, and casualty insurance, which addresses legal liabilities resulting from accidents or injuries to others. The core principle of P&C insurance is to transfer risk from the policyholder to the insurer in exchange for premium payments. Common types of P&C policies include homeowners, auto, and commercial liability insurance. These policies provide coverage for unexpected events such as natural disasters, theft, accidents, and legal claims. Understanding the basics of P&C insurance is crucial for making informed decisions about coverage needs and ensuring adequate protection against potential risks. Risk Management and Insurance Principles

Risk management is a critical concept in property and casualty insurance, focusing on identifying, assessing, and mitigating risks to minimize potential losses. Insurance principles, such as indemnity, insurable interest, and utmost good faith, form the foundation of P&C policies. Understanding these principles helps agents and policyholders navigate coverage options and legal requirements. Study guides often emphasize the importance of risk transfer, where individuals or businesses shift financial risks to insurers. They also explore types of risks, including liability, property damage, and business interruption, and how policies address these exposures. By mastering these principles, professionals can better advise clients and design effective insurance strategies. Types of Property and Casualty Insurance Coverage

Property and casualty insurance offers various coverage types to protect individuals and businesses from diverse risks. Homeowners insurance covers damage to homes and personal property, while auto insurance protects against vehicle-related losses. Commercial insurance is tailored for businesses, covering liability, property damage, and workplace accidents. Liability insurance addresses legal responsibilities for injuries or property damage to others. Umbrella insurance provides additional coverage beyond standard policy limits. Each type is designed to mitigate specific risks, ensuring financial protection.
